The Department of Law at Madhav University, Sirohi, is a constituent college that offers legal education in Rajasthan, India. The department is approved by the Bar Council of India (BCI) and offers a diverse range of law programmes, from undergraduate to postgraduate and doctoral degrees.
Department of Law admission to the Department of Law is designed to select talented and deserving candidates for its various programmes. Most of the courses of the department are based on a merit-based admission process. In the case of undergraduate programmes like LLB and BA LLB, admissions may be based on the candidate's performance in their qualifying examination.
Postgraduate admissions for LLM programmes may be based on the candidate's academic performance in their bachelor's degree. Department of Law Degree wise Admission Process The Department of Law provides an array of training and educational courses to meet different parameters and subfields under the practice of law. It offers an array of 7 full-time courses. Students can check the course details mentioned below Department of Law LLB Admission Process LLB: The department provides 3-year LLB course with an approved intake of 180 seats.
The intake is most probably based on the candidate's performance in the qualifying examination. The eligibility includes a bachelor's degree in any discipline from a recognised university. Department of Law BA LLB Admission Process BA LLB is an integrated, 5-year approved programme with intake capacity of 180 seats.
